News Celebrities and Special Auction Items Announced for 2010 Broadway Flea Market; Daniel Craig's T-Shirt, Anyone? Initial stars and auction items have been announced for the 24th Annual Broadway Flea Market and Grand Auction, set for 10 AM-7 PM Sept. 26 in the theatre district's Shubert Alley and West 44th Street.

The outdoor event raises money for Broadway Cares/Equity Fights AIDS and features a host of theatrical memorabilia donated by the theatrical community. The day-long benefit also boasts a Celebrity Table, where theatre fans can purchase autographs by or photos with their favorite stars from Broadway, Off-Broadway and television serials. The traditionally well-attended event also includes a Grand Auction, where "singular items and opportunities such as walk-on roles in Broadway shows, television programs and films" are auctioned to the highest bidder.

Celebrities scheduled to appear at the 2010 Celebrity Autograph Table and Photo Booth in exchange for donations to BC/EFA include: Kate Baldwin (Finian's Rainbow), Bryan Batt (TV's "Mad Men"), Susan Blackwell ([title of show]), Heidi Blickenstaff ([title of show]), Mario Cantone ("Sex and the City"), Kathleen Chalfant (Angels in America), Stephanie D'Abruzzo (Avenue Q), Jason Danieley (Next to Normal), Ana Gasteyer (Wicked & "Saturday Night Live"), Malcolm Gets (The Story of My Life), Mandy Gonzalez (Wicked, In the Heights), Montego Glover (Memphis), Julie Halston (The Divine Sister), Ann Harada (Avenue Q), Jessica Hecht (A View From the Bridge), Matthew Hydzik (West Side Story), Cheyenne Jackson (Xanadu, Finian's Rainbow), Gregory Jbara (Billy Elliot), Andy Karl (Wicked), Chad Kimball (Memphis), Levi Kreis (Million Dollar Quartet), Dan Lauria (Lombardi), Aaron Lazar (A Little Night Music), Judith Light (Lombardi), Robert Britton Lyons (Million Dollar Quartet), David Andrew MacDonald ("Guiding Light"), Marin Mazzie (Next to Normal), Debra Monk (Curtains), Julia Murney (Wicked), Kelli O'Hara (South Pacific), Patrick Page (Spider-Man Turn Off the Dark), Karine Plantadit (Come Fly Away), Anthony Rapp (Rent), Vanessa Ray (Hair & "As the World Turns"), Alice Ripley (Next to Normal), Chita Rivera (Nine, Kiss of the Spider Woman), Elizabeth Stanley (Million Dollar Quartet), John Tartaglia (Shrek The Musical & Avenue Q) and Colleen Zenk ("As the World Turns"). More participants will be announced closer to the event. All appearances are subject to change.

The following lots are included in the auction and will be up for bidding: a walk-on role in Broadway's The Phantom of the Opera, Mamma Mia!, In the Heights, Rock of Ages and Wicked; one of the prosthetic headpieces worn by Brian d'Arcy James in Shrek The Musical, signed by the entire original Broadway cast; "Good Morning Baltimore" musical phrase from Hairspray, handwritten and signed by Marc Shaiman and Scott Wittman; the last pair of tickets to the sold out New York Times "TimesTalks" featuring Frank Rich and Stephen Sondheim on Nov. 22, with the chance to meet Rich and Sondheim afterward; the chance to conduct the orchestra of The Phantom of the Opera during the exit music at one performance; dinner with Anthony Rapp; "When You're an Addams" musical phrase from The Addams Family, handwritten and signed by Andrew Lippa; "Walk Like A Man" musical phrase from Jersey Boys, handwritten and signed by Bob Gaudio and Frankie Valli; "For Good" musical phrase from Wicked, handwritten and signed by Stephen Schwartz; the opportunity to have Jonathan Freeman, who voiced the villainous "Jafar" in the "Aladdin" film, to record your phone message; Daniel Craig's tank top that he wore during a performance of A Steady Rain, autographed by Daniel Craig and Hugh Jackman; a poster from Susan Sarandon's Exit the King dressing room that was signed by over 50 celebrities who visited her backstage during the show's run; a 2010 Tony Awards poster signed by all of the presenters and nominees; and autographed items from celebs such as Antonio Banderas, Corbin Bleu, Carol Channing, Kristin Chenoweth, Gavin Creel, Raul Esparza, Green Day, Marvin Hamlisch, Angela Lansbury, Liza Minnelli, Bernadette Peters, Daniel Radcliffe, Vanessa Redgrave, Lynn Redgrave, Stephen Sondheim, John Stamos, Meryl Streep, Kevin Spacey, Barbra Streisand, Elizabeth Taylor, Doris Eaton Travis, Vanessa Williams and many more.

* The 2009 Flea Market — held Sept. 27 in the Roseland Ballroom — raised $403,929 for Broadway Cares/Equity Fights AIDS. BC/EFA auctioneer Lorna Kelly and actor Bryan Batt ("Mad Men") presided over the Grand Auction, which raised $175,000; while Michael Goddard and Felicia Finley (Catch Me If You Can) hosted the silent auction, which raised $36,590; the autograph table and photo booths raised $14,770; and other various tables collectively raised $192,429.

Broadway Cares/Equity Fights AIDS is the nation's largest industry-based, nonprofit AIDS fundraising and grant-making organization. Since its founding in 1988 the organization has distributed over $170 million for services for people with AIDS, HIV or HIV-related illnesses.
